This paper gives a brief introduction of a whole process, of which,the Barg Mongolians’ migration from the Gazhur temple to the Hulunbuirprairie and their settlement in there. Furthermore, plenty of data anddocuments are adopted in this essay for introducing Ganzur temple,Gazur religious rites and Ganzur Bazaar. Ganzur religious rites normallyhosted once a year. In the rites, many religious believers surroundingGanzur temple, came to worship, simultaneously it provided a goodbusiness platform to merchants. At the same time, along with theformation of Temple Fair, it made herdsmen in worship obtain theirnecessities in the market. Additionally, Huge commercial profits not onlyhave attracted domestic merchants to come to do business, but also havedriven foreign business men from Russia, Japan, Europe and the UnitedStates come to the market for commercial activities. Therefore, uniqueGanzur temple Fair came to appearance and be well known in all overworld. Ganzur as Hulunbuir region’s largest lama temple, the templeplayed a far-reaching influence on the spread of Tibetan Buddhism(Lamaism) to the local Mongolian people and even on the national fate.However, From the perspective of more than two hundred years’development course of Ganzur temple, it brought about somedisadvantages to the local Mongolians too, but for the role it played in theHulunbuir region’s economic development and cultural exchanges alsocannot be ignored.
